CLAIM FAILS
JUDGMENT IN FAVOUR OF EORD ROTHERMERE PRINCESS’S CONTRACT OF SERVICE. EXPIRATION BY EFFLUXION OF TIME. Sy felegraph—Press Association —Copyright (Received This Day, 10.15 a.m.) LONDON, November 15. Mr Justice Tucker, in giving judgment in favour of Lord Rothcrmere, with costs, said he was satisfied that until June, 1938. Princess Stephanie was still at Lord Rothermere’s call, bu she was paid until December, 1938 when the contract expired through Effluxion of time. Lord Rothcrmere never undertook contractually to vindicate the Princess or promised contractually to maintain her for life.
